Organic Wine Clubs: What Sets Plonk Apart?

Plonk Wine Club offers a curated experience that takes you on a journey through lesser-known wine regions like Croatia, Slovenia, Greece, and Hungary. The club focuses on wines made from indigenous grape varieties that are native to their specific place of origin.

All Natural Wines: The Plonk Promise

Plonk is committed to offering wines that are grown using organic, biodynamic, and sustainable vineyard practices. This means you won’t find any pesticides, herbicides, or commercial additives such as colorants, acidifiers, artificial sugars, or industrial chemicals in these wines.

Plonk Wine Club Review: Types of Organic Wine Clubs
Plonk offers three main types of wine clubs:
- Mixed Organic Wine Club: A mix of reds, whites, rosé, and bubbly from over 20 domestic and international regions.
- Red Organic Wine Club: Focuses on adventurous reds from top domestic and international producers.
- White Organic Wine Club: Offers a range of distinctive whites from forward-thinking wineries around the world.
How It Works: Step-by-Step
- Pick Your Wine Club: Choose from all reds, all whites, or a rotating selection.
- Choose Your Bottle Count: Customize your case with 4, 6, or 12 bottles per shipment.
- Select Your Subscription Type: Pay month-to-month or choose a prepaid package of 3, 6, or 12 shipments.
Delivery and Billing
It’s important to note that an adult signature is required for delivery. Billing for subscriptions takes place at the time of purchase for the first month and then on the 1st day of each subsequent month. Prepaid subscriptions do not auto-renew.
